互联网公司GitHub repo 语言使用情况
做 PPT 太無聊了,突然想到可以統(tǒng)計(jì)一下這個(gè)東西,于是就做了一下
現(xiàn)在基本上所有國(guó)外大公司和國(guó)內(nèi)部分公司都在 GitHub 上開源了一部分代碼。統(tǒng)計(jì)一下這些代碼的語言使用情況,多少可以反映公司內(nèi)部對(duì)語言的偏好。很多公司流行的項(xiàng)目都是單獨(dú)建一個(gè) repo的,沒辦法統(tǒng)計(jì),所以這里統(tǒng)計(jì)大家就隨便看看吧。使用了 GitHub 的 API,只有不到四十行代碼,所以直接貼在這里了,復(fù)制下來裝個(gè) requests 就可以直接運(yùn)行
統(tǒng)計(jì)的公司包括 MS,amazon,google, twitter, facebook, 阿里。其中 amazon 似乎只開源了 aws 相關(guān)的代碼,不過也算進(jìn)來了。本來想找百度和騰訊的,結(jié)果發(fā)現(xiàn)百度沒有一個(gè)統(tǒng)一的 organization,都是按產(chǎn)品散著的,騰訊則基本沒有開源代碼。。。
下面是統(tǒng)計(jì)結(jié)果,每個(gè)公司只取前五名
阿里
| Java | 13 |
| C | 8 |
| C++ | 2 |
| JavaScript | 2 |
| Perl | 2 |
| JavaScript | 9 |
| C++ | 4 |
| Ruby | 4 |
| Python | 3 |
| Java | 3 |
| Scala | 14 |
| Ruby | 9 |
| Java | 3 |
| Python,CSS,JavaScrit,Shell | 1 |
| Java | 8 |
| C++ | 5 |
| PHP | 4 |
| C | 3 |
| Python, Js, Objective-C | 2 |
aws
| Java | 8 |
| Ruby | 6 |
| PHP | 4 |
| JavaScript | 3 |
| Objective-C | 3 |
咳咳,最后是大微軟,說實(shí)話我也不確定要不要把微軟算成互聯(lián)網(wǎng)公司。。。
| C# | 29 |
| C++ | 1 |
從這個(gè)非常不靠譜的統(tǒng)計(jì)來看,Java 果然還是最流行的語言啊。。。不會(huì) Java 感覺壓力真的好大 orz
from:?https://laike9m.com/blog/hu-lian-wang-gong-si-github-repo-yu-yan-shi-yong-qing-kuang,56/
總結(jié)
以上是生活随笔為你收集整理的互联网公司GitHub repo 语言使用情况的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Apriori算法简介及实现(pytho
- 下一篇: 深度学习Deep learning:四十